Hotel is on a quieter street in a safe area near Ball State University. Compared to other Best Western properties, it was on par. Positives: Very large, clean, properly heated indoor pool. Quiet except for guests above stomping around occasionally. Friendly front desk receptionist. Negatives: Small breakfast area with limited choices.
